About Heiji Nakano

Heiji Nakano is a scholar working on Aquatic Science, Immunology and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, having authored 12 papers that have together received 788 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Invertebrate Immune Response Mechanisms (8 papers), Aquaculture disease management and microbiota (5 papers) and Aquaculture Nutrition and Growth (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Insect Science (454 citations), Immunology (746 citations) and Aquatic Science (131 citations). Heiji Nakano has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, United States and Switzerland. Frequent co-authors include Kazuo Momoyama, Kiyoshi Inouye, Midori Hiraoka, Takeshi Kimura, Norihisa Oseko, Keisuke Yamano, Satoshi Miwa, Shigetoshi Miyajima, Jun Kobayashi and Motohiko Sano. Their work appears in journals such as Fish Pathology.
